Noah Education Announces Unaudited Fourth Quarter and Full Fiscal Year 2010 Financial Results
SHENZHEN, China, Aug. 30 /PRNewswire-Asia-FirstCall/ -- Noah Education Holdings Ltd. (NYSE: NED) ("Noah" or "the Company"), a leading provider of supplemental education products and services in China, today announced its unaudited financial results for the fourth quarter and full fiscal year ended June 30, 2010. Fourth Quarter Fiscal 2010 Financial Highlights -- Net revenue for the quarter decreased by 71.9% to RMB33.5 million (US$4.9 million), compared with RMB119.1 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al 2009 -- Gross loss was RMB3.8 million (US$0.5 million), compared with gross profit of RMB61.5 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al 2009 -- Operating loss was RMB89.4 million (US$13.2 ...

Alon Holdings Blue Square - Israel Ltd. Announces Financial Results for the First Half and Second Quarter of 2010
The Company Presents Continued Improvement in the Business Results and the Operating Indices in the First Half and Second Quarter of 2010 - The operating profit in the first half of 2010 grew to 3.8% of the sales as compared to 3.3% in the comparable half last year. - The operating profit in the supermarket segment was 3.9% in the first half and 4.2% in the second quarter of 2010. - The strategic steps in the bee group including the move to a single modern logistics center and the merger of the corporate headquarters lead to one-off expenses in the first half. - The net income for the first half increased by 16.7%.
